> Description
> -------
> 
> Fix memory leak with Dropbox version control plugin.
> 
> The Dropbox plugins creates a new QLocalSocket on each
> beginRetrieval call and this socket should be deleted again
> in endRetrieval. But if Dropbox is not running or doesn't respond
> beginRetrieval will return false and so endRetrieval won't be called -> memory leak.
> 
> In the current version we only call endRetrieval when
> beginRetrieval was successfully in UpdateItemStatesThread::run(). 
> This causes some problems with version control plugins (like Dropbox plugin), 
> which have to do cleanups in endRetrieval.
> 
> Now we always call endRetrieval after beginRetrieval when updating the version states.
> 
> The Dropbox plugin is the only official version control plugin which really uses endRetrieval,
> the other plugins have an empty endRetrieval. Because of that I think it is safe enough
> for 4.13.1.
